Title:
Charles Dexter Allen His Book
Description:
A bookplate depicting a man reading a book by candlelight. There are vines in between the text and around the image. There are lanterns on the top and bottom. The man is most likely Charles Dexter Allen, the bookplate collector. Charles Dexter Allen was a bookplate collector born in 1865 and lived in Windsor Locks Connecticut until he died in 1926. He was a member of the Grolier Club from 1894 to 1907 and an active member of the Stowaways Club. He was an editor of the Hartford Post from 1895 to 1897 and Editor of the In Lantern Land in 1898. He’s also been listed as a notable writer and editor for Marquis Who’s Who. He was a writer and artist and was interested in artists' prints, books, and drawings. He’s written many books including “The Bookplates of William Fowler Hopson.”
The creator of the bookplate, William Fowler Hopson (1849-1935), was a painter, engraver, etcher, and illustrator, but he was best known for his bookplates.
